I just bought a 2010 370 Sundancer leftover and I was wondering if the dealer should have offered me the extended warrany, if there is one? If so, is it for all components including the Merc engines?
Any help is appreciated.
Thanks-
 
I can't speak for the 370 specifically, but I bought a 2010 240 DA last year and the dealer encouraged the extended warranty. It extended my boats warranty to 7 years. It's also transferrable, so it will help with resell when I upgrade.

I was at my dealer two weekends ago looking at a 2008 350 (The 2010 370) and it had an extended warranty good for another 4 years.

I know the warranty covers much of the SeaRay components and some of the electronics. I don't remember to what extent it covers on the engine, but that is a question for your dealer.

One note, there is an extended warranty option that if you pay a little extra up front and never use the warranty, you get your money back!

**Our extended warranty was offered to us during the closing process.

Warranty coverage can vary. There are different packages, covering differing amounts of the boat.
 
Hello I bought a 2009 350 left over there is a extended warranty offered by merc that will cover dts and the engines for an additional 3 years it was quoted at around 2300 per engine to extend the coverage the horizons are warrantied for 4 years so you can ask to see how much the dealer will charge you I was told I have a year to put the warranty in play so im still thinking about it since my vessel view was just replaced and I had a dts faliur on last saturday so Im thinking it may be a good idea good luck cant hurt to ask

We bought a 2011 this year and the 5 year factory warranty was thrown in with the deal. Boat and motor/drive train included.

It's our understanding you can get the extended warranty as long as the orig factory warranty is still valid.

You can shop around for the extended warranty too in most states.
Dealer mark-up on the cost is over 100% so their is a lot of room for negotiation.

Ya only need to use it once for it to pay for itself.

My boat came with a 4 year warranty from Mercury. I purchased the 3 year extended warranty (7 years total) and it has almost paid for itself in the first year alone. They have been very good with repairs. The engines and drives are your biggest concern. I'm glad I got it. Good luck! Brian
